The Role: Cloud Engineer - Oracle Fusion & Cloud Infrastructure
This is a critical technical role focused on the design, implementation, and maintenance of secure, high-availability cloud environments, directly supporting the operation and integration of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P, HCM, and SCM applications.
You will be instrumental in managing the Oracle Cloud Infrastructure landscape, driving DevOps automation, optimising performance, and ensuring compliance across all environments. This role is suited to someone passionate about cloud automation, infrastructure security, and the operational excellence of mission-critical ERP systems.
Key Responsibilities & Focus Areas
OCI Infrastructure Management: Design, deploy, and maintain Oracle Cloud Infrastructure resources, including compute, networking, storage, and security. Manage environment provisioning, maintenance, and synchronisation for the Oracle Fusion Cloud landscape.
Automation & DevOps: Develop and maintain Infrastructure as Code using Terraform or OCI Resource Manager. Implement CI/CD pipelines for Fusion extensions and integrations using tools such as Jenkins, GitLab, or Azure DevOps.
Fusion Environment Control: Manage and support the technical operations around Fusion quarterly updates, patches, and custom deployments. Ensure effective version control and environment synchronisation across the Fusion lifecycle.
Security & Compliance: Implement and monitor security best practices for OCI and Fusion, managing IAM, roles, and policies. Ensure technical compliance with ITIL and SOX frameworks.
Performance & Support: Analyse, optimise, and troubleshoot complex issues involving Fusion environments, OCI services, and cloud/on-premise integrations. Collaborate with Oracle Support for critical service request management.
Essential Knowledge, Skills, and Experience
5-8 years of experience in Cloud Engineering or Infrastructure roles, with a strong focus on Oracle technologies.
Hands-on expertise with Oracle Cloud Infrastructure components, including networking, compute, storage, security, and IAM.
Practical experience managing the technical operations and environment maintenance for Oracle Fusion Cloud ERP, HCM, and SCM.
Strong knowledge of DevOps, CI/CD, and Infrastructure as Code using tools such as Terraform and Ansible.
Proficiency in Linux/Unix environments, scripting with Bash or Python, and version control using Git.
Demonstrable experience managing Fusion quarterly updates, patches, and related integrations.
Strong troubleshooting, analytical, and cross-functional communication skills.
Desirable Skills
Oracle Cloud Infrastructure Certified Architect / Professional.
Familiarity with Oracle Integration Cloud and API Gateway configurations.
Experience with monitoring and alerting tools, such as OCI Monitoring, Grafana, or Splunk. xwzovoh
Exposure to other major cloud platforms, including AWS or Azure.
